LETTER 526. TO J.D. HOOKER. Down, September 28th [1861].

Chapter 16854 wordsPublic domain

It is, I believe, true that Glen Roy shelves (I remember your Indian letter) were formed by glacial lakes. I persuaded Mr. Jamieson, an excellent observer, to go and observe them; and this is his result. There are some great difficulties to be explained, but I presume this will ultimately be proved the truth...
